About Converting Fluid ounce per Years to Cubic yard per Weeks
Fluid ounce per Years and Cubic yard per Weeks both measure volumetric flow rate — how much volume passes a point over time — used to size pipes and pumps, monitor river or stream discharge, control industrial processes, and set medical infusion rates. Both are volumetric flow rate units.
Formula
cubic yard per weeks = fluid ounce per years × 7.413294e-7
This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 fluid ounce per years equals 9.371478e-13 base units, and 1 cubic yard per weeks equals 0.00000126414493714 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ct fluid ounce per years-to-cubic yard per weeks factor of 7.413294e-7.

What's the difference between volumetric and mass flow rate?
Volumetric flow rate measures the volume of fluid passing a point per unit time (for example, liters per second). Mass flow rate measures the mass instead. For a fluid of constant density the two are directly proportional, but for compressible fluids like gases, mass flow is often the more meaningful quantity.
